Geekbench 5 Benchmarks
Intel Core i7-9700F | vs | Intel Core i5-9600K |
---|---|---|
Apr 23rd, 2019 | Release Date | Oct 19th, 2018 |
Core i7 | Collection | Core i5 |
Coffee Lake | Codename | Coffee Lake |
Intel Socket 1151 | Socket | Intel Socket 1151 |
Desktop | Segment | Desktop |
8 | Cores | 6 |
8 | Threads | 6 |
3.0 GHz | Base Clock Speed | 3.7 GHz |
4.7 GHz | Turbo Clock Speed | 4.6 GHz |
65 W | TDP | 95 W |
14 nm | Process Size | 14 nm |
30.0x | Multiplier | 37.0x |
None | Integrated Graphics | UHD 630 |
No | Overclockable | Yes |
